Benefits of AI in Academic Writing

AI offers several compelling advantages for academic writers. By automating repetitive tasks and providing intelligent assistance, AI tools can significantly improve efficiency, accuracy, and the overall quality of research papers. Let's examine some of the key benefits in detail.

Enhanced Efficiency

One of the most significant benefits of AI in academic writing is its ability to enhance efficiency. AI-powered tools can automate time-consuming tasks such as literature searches, data analysis, and initial draft generation. This allows researchers to focus on higher-level cognitive tasks such as critical thinking, conceptualization, and refining arguments. For instance, AI can quickly scan through vast databases of research articles to identify relevant sources, saving researchers countless hours of manual searching. Moreover, AI can assist in data analysis by identifying patterns and trends that might be missed by human analysts, thereby accelerating the research process. Ultimately, by streamlining these tasks, AI enables researchers to allocate their time more effectively and produce more high-quality work.

Improved Accuracy

Accuracy is paramount in academic writing, and AI can play a crucial role in ensuring that research papers are free of errors. AI tools can help detect and correct grammatical errors, spelling mistakes, and inconsistencies in style and formatting. Additionally, AI can assist in verifying the accuracy of citations and references, ensuring that all sources are properly credited. Furthermore, AI algorithms can be trained to identify potential biases or inaccuracies in data analysis, helping researchers to present their findings in a more objective and reliable manner. By minimizing errors and ensuring consistency, AI can significantly enhance the credibility and trustworthiness of academic research papers. It is also vital to remember that AI's accuracy is only as good as the data it is trained on. Always critically evaluate the output.

Access to a Wider Knowledge Base

AI can provide researchers with access to a broader range of information and resources than they might otherwise be able to access. AI-powered search engines and databases can quickly scan through vast amounts of information, identifying relevant articles, studies, and data sets. This can be particularly useful for researchers working in interdisciplinary fields or those who need to stay up-to-date with the latest developments in their area of expertise. Moreover, AI can help researchers identify potential collaborators or experts in their field, facilitating knowledge sharing and collaboration. By expanding access to information and resources, AI can help researchers to develop more comprehensive and well-informed research papers. While AI may provide access to more information, human discernment in the validity of sources is still important.

AI Tools for Academic Writing

A variety of AI tools are available to assist researchers in academic writing, each with its unique strengths and capabilities. These tools can be broadly categorized into several types, including writing assistants, literature review tools, data analysis platforms, and plagiarism checkers. Understanding the capabilities of each type of tool is crucial for selecting the right tool for a specific task.

Writing Assistants

AI-powered writing assistants, such as Grammarly and ProWritingAid, can help researchers improve the clarity, grammar, and style of their writing. These tools use natural language processing (NLP) to identify and correct errors in grammar, spelling, punctuation, and sentence structure. They can also provide suggestions for improving word choice, sentence flow, and overall readability. Furthermore, some writing assistants offer features such as plagiarism detection and style guides, helping researchers to ensure that their writing meets the standards of academic integrity. While these tools can be valuable for polishing and refining research papers, it's important to remember that they are not a substitute for careful proofreading and editing by the researcher. They are also not replacements for human understanding of the underlying concepts.

Literature Review Tools

Literature reviews are an essential component of academic research, but they can also be time-consuming and labor-intensive. AI content generation platforms can help researchers to quickly identify and synthesize relevant articles and studies. These tools use machine learning algorithms to analyze vast databases of research papers, identifying key themes, concepts, and relationships. They can also generate summaries of articles, create concept maps, and identify potential gaps in the literature. By automating many of the tasks involved in literature reviews, these tools can save researchers significant time and effort, allowing them to focus on the more strategic aspects of their research. Researchers should use these tools to inform their own analysis.

Data Analysis Platforms

For researchers who work with quantitative data, AI-powered data analysis platforms can be invaluable. These platforms, such as IBM Watson Analytics and Google AI Platform, offer a range of tools for data mining, statistical analysis, and predictive modeling. They can help researchers to identify patterns, trends, and relationships in their data, as well as to generate insights that might not be apparent through traditional methods. Moreover, these platforms often provide visualizations and interactive dashboards, making it easier to communicate findings to a wider audience. However, it's important to note that these platforms require a certain level of expertise in data analysis and statistical modeling. Researchers should have a solid understanding of the underlying principles before using these tools. AI tools can enhance the analytical process, but the underlying assumptions and limitations should be understood by the researcher.

Plagiarism is a serious ethical violation in academic research, and it's essential for researchers to ensure that their work is original. AI-powered plagiarism checkers, such as Turnitin and iThenticate, can help researchers to identify instances of plagiarism in their writing. These tools compare the text of a research paper against a vast database of published works, identifying any passages that are similar or identical to other sources. They also provide reports that highlight the potential instances of plagiarism, allowing researchers to address them before submitting their work for publication. It is important to use these tools as a final check and be sure to properly cite all sources. Using AI plagiarism checkers can help avoid unintentional plagiarism and maintain academic integrity. However, researchers must understand the reports to ensure proper citations are made.

Best Practices for Using AI in Academic Writing

While AI offers numerous benefits for academic writing, it's crucial to use these tools responsibly and ethically. Researchers should adhere to certain best practices to ensure that they are using AI in a way that enhances their work without compromising academic integrity. One of the primary things to remember is that AI is a tool and not a replacement for original thought.

Understand the Limitations of AI

AI tools are not perfect, and they have certain limitations that researchers should be aware of. For example, AI-powered writing assistants may not always understand the nuances of academic language, and they may sometimes make incorrect suggestions. Similarly, AI-powered literature review tools may miss relevant articles or misinterpret the findings of studies. It's important for researchers to critically evaluate the output of AI tools and to use their own judgment to determine whether the suggestions or findings are accurate and appropriate. Researchers should always be in control of the process and not rely solely on AI. Relying too heavily on AI tools without human oversight can lead to errors or omissions. Always carefully review and verify the output of AI tools to ensure accuracy and relevance.

One of the most important considerations when using AI in academic writing is to maintain academic integrity. Researchers should always properly cite all sources, including those that are identified by AI-powered literature review tools. They should also avoid using AI to generate content that is not their own original work. While AI can be used to assist in the content writing process, it should not be used to replace the researcher's own thinking and analysis. It is important to follow ethical guidelines and adhere to the standards of academic integrity. Always disclose the use of AI tools in your research and writing. This promotes transparency and allows others to understand the role of AI in your work. This also involves understanding the institution's policy regarding the use of AI tools.

Even with the assistance of AI, critical thinking skills remain essential for academic researchers. AI tools can provide valuable insights and suggestions, but it's up to the researcher to evaluate these findings and determine whether they are valid and relevant. Researchers should be able to critically analyze the output of AI tools, identify potential biases or limitations, and draw their own conclusions. Critical thinking is also essential for ensuring that the researcher's work is original and innovative. AI can assist with routine tasks, but it cannot replace the creativity and insight that come from human thought. Researchers should always strive to develop their critical thinking skills and use AI as a tool to enhance their own intellectual abilities. The synergy of human intellect and AI-powered tools can lead to groundbreaking discoveries and innovative solutions.
